C S Lewis, the 20th century atheist who became a Christian, once said, “I believe in Christianity as I believe that the sun has risen; not only because I see it, but because by it I see everything else.” It is like that with the Christian Bible. By it we understand the big questions of life — origins, meaning, and destiny. The Bible tells that story. But today we will look at a particular part of that theme; God as our teacher on the subject of redemption, and our role as His students.
